Jesus Culture began in the summer of 1999, when the youth group at Bethel Church in Redding, California, led by Banning Liebscher, launched the first Jesus Culture conference. During this time they began leading worship at Jesus Culture conferences both nationally and internationally and thus the Jesus Culture band was formed. The band consists of Kim Walker-Smith (Vocals) and Chris Quilala (Vocals and Guitar) as worship leaders along with Jeffrey Kunde (Lead Guitar), Brandon Aaronson (Bass), Ian McIntosh (Keys) and Josh Fisher (Drums). Culture Club was a popular 1980s pop group, perhaps most noticeable for their gender-bending frontman Boy George. The other members of the band were Roy Hay on guitars and keyboards, Mikey Craig playing bass and Jon Moss (ex Damned, London, Adam and the Ants) on drums. Their first album, 1982's Kissing to Be Clever, became a major international hit, spawning the hit singles "Do You Really Want to Hurt Me" (which went 'all the way' in the BBC-Charts in late 1982), "Time (Clock of the Heart)", and "I'll Tumble 4 Ya". Cruel Force is a German black metal/thrash metal band formed in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any in 2008 and during the same year they released their first demo, "Into the Crypts...". After that they were quiet for almost two years until the label Heavy Force picked them up. In 2010 they released their first full-length, "The Rise of Satanic Might", only 500 copies were printed. In February, 2011, they released the single "Ancient Black Spirit" and in the 20th of June their second full-lenght album, "Under the Sign of the Moon", was released. Discography Into the Crypts...
